Ivey Moody, Jr, 66, went to be with our Lord and Savior last night May 7, 2018. He will be missed tremendously by his family and friends.
Visitation will be held 7:00 p.m. to 9:00 p.m. Wednesday, May 9, 2018 at Howard-Carter Funeral Home and other times at the home. Funeral service will be held 11:00 a.m. Thursday, May 10, 2018 at Howard- Carter Funeral Home with Pastor Rick Mondell officiating. Burial will follow the funeral service at Oak Ridge Memorial Park in Pink Hill.
Ivey was a Veteran and proudly served his country in the US Army. He was a member of the Vietnam Veterans of America, Chapter 892, the American Legion Post 43, VFW Post 2771, and the DAV.
Ivey was predeceased by his parents Geneva Dowdy and Ivey Moody Sr.
He is survived by his wife of 48 years Judy Moody; his sons Ricky Moody and wife Aimee and David Moody. His daughter Melissa Moody Guzman and husband Samuel. His grandchildren, Josh, Zachary, Ariana, Adam, Ava, Adrian, and Jose. A special little fur baby, Maggie. He is also survived by his two sisters Barbara Edwards and Brenda Heath and husband Bud of Kinston.
Ivey enjoyed camping at White Oak Shores, having big Sunday dinners with all his family, and listening to his favorite music by Gene Watson.
